Xbox Experience: Austria plans mega launch event

Xbox Austria has ambitious plans for the launch of the next generation Xbox. In Austria, the introduction of the Xbox 360 will be accompanied by an 11-day event bonanza entitled “Xbox Experience”.

Xbox Experience will take place in the period of Nov 24 to Dec 4 in Vienna’s MAK (Museum of Applied Arts). Spaced over an area of 1,400 square meters, visitors can expect a unique experience related to the Xbox 360.

The free event takes place every day from 2 pm and is open until late night (with the exception of Dec 1st which is reserved for the Xbox 360 launch party).

Visitors will be able to play-test a number of Xbox 360 games for the first time. Around 100 Xbox 360 systems will be available for this purpose.

For an optimal gaming experience, all games will be presented on Samsung HD LCD televisions. For competitive gamers, many competions and championships will be held during the entire event duration.

The Xbox Experience event will also include an Xbox 360 shop offering the new console, accessories, exclusive merchandise and all launch titles - as long as stocks last.

A cosy chill-out area will invite gamers to take a break or just hang out. Several food and drink corners will be available to supply gamers with energy for further battles and races on the Xbox 360.

At night, the Xbox Experience will change into Austria’s coolest concert and clubbing venue. The finals of the “Xbox 360 Sound Invasion Band Contest” will be held, and big-name live acts and DJs will further provide highest quality entertainment.
